Should you choose a fixed or withdrawable circuit breaker?

One of the critical decisions when designing or upgrading switchgear is choosing between fixed and withdrawable circuit breakers. Each type has its advantages and is suited for different applications. The choice depends on various factors, including reliability, maintenance requirements, operational flexibility, and cost.

What are the advantages of withdrawable circuit breakers?

One of the main advantages of withdrawable circuit breakers is their ease of maintenance. Since they can be removed from the switchgear panel without disconnecting cables or affecting adjacent equipment, they allow for faster inspections, testing, and replacements. This is particularly beneficial in applications where downtime must be minimized.
